SetScaleRatio メソッド

構文

BOOL SetScaleRatio(DOUBLE dRatio);

印刷時の縮尺を設定します。

パラメータ

bAuto
自動設定。値が1の場合、有効になります。
dRatio
縮尺値。自動設定が無効(値が0)の場合、設定されます。

戻り値

印刷時の縮尺を設定できた場合は 0 以外を返します。開けなかった場合は 0 を返します。

使用例

// C++ sample
// 間取りオブジェクトへ接続
CMadoriDoc * m_MadoriDoc = new CMadoriDoc();
CLSIDFromProgID (L"MyHomeDesignerMadori.MadoriDoc", &clsid);
GetActiveObject (clsid, NULL, &pUnk);
pUnk->QueryInterface (IID_IDispatch, (void**)(&pDisp));
m_MadoriDoc->AttachDispatch (pDisp);

// 縮尺を変更します。
BOOL bRet = FALSE;
bRet = m_MadoriDoc->SetScaleRatio(FALSE, 75);

AfxMessageBox(bRet);

// JavaScript sample
var doc = new CMadoriDoc();
var result = doc.SetScaleRatio(false, 75);
alert(result);